Stellantis (FCA US, LLC) has recently made waves with the granting of its groundbreaking patent for the Electric Drive Module (EDM), which features an integrated winch system. This innovative leap, originally filed with the U.S. Patent and Trademark Office (USPTO) on January 25, 2024, and granted on January 21, 2025, signifies potential changes to electrified Jeep® off-road capability.

The patent outlines a unique gearbox assembly, enabling the electric motor to provide drive torque to either the vehicle’s wheels or the integrated winch. This dual-function capability means off-road enthusiasts may soon benefit from having a built-in winch without needing external systems. According to the USPTO, "the patent details a unique gearbox assembly...without needing an external electric or hydraulic system." This design aims to streamline off-road recovery equipment, reducing weight and complexity.

The Electric Drive Module works by distributing torque to the front or rear axles under standard driving conditions. Once switched to winch mode, it redirects power from the electric motor to a planetary gear set, effectively activating the winch spool. This eliminates the requirement for a separate winch motor, which is significant as it simplifies installation and operation. The integrated design allows for the winch to be housed within the vehicle's front fascia or engine bay, preserving both aesthetics and functionality.

Beyond the integrated winch, the planetary gear set's ability to facilitate power redirection plays a key role. It allows for seamless transitions between drive and winch modes with minimal power loss, making it incredibly user-friendly—especially for drivers who find themselves stuck or need to pull another vehicle out of difficulty.

What’s exciting is the potential for this technology to be incorporated across Stellantis' electrified SUV and truck line-up. The focus appears to be on vehicles traditionally associated with rugged capabilities, like the Jeep Wrangler and Gladiator. If implemented, Jeep owners might enjoy electric-powered winching capabilities at their fingertips.

Meanwhile, Volkswagen has been turning heads with its ID.7 Pro S, which achieved an astonishing range of 941 kilometers on a single charge during its testing phase this past December at Nardó, Italy. Sporting an 86 kWh battery, the ID.7 Pro S recorded energy consumption of merely 9.2 kWh/100 km during tests where it was driven at 29 km/h to simulate urban conditions, showcasing remarkable efficiency.

The ID.7 Pro S has not only surpassed its official WLTP range of 709 kilometers by nearly one-third, but its aerodynamic design and advanced drive system lay the groundwork for its exceptional performance. Volkswagen enthused, "...the ID.7 Pro S surpassed its official WLTP range of 709 kilometers by nearly one-third!" This positions the ID.7 Pro S as one of the most efficient electric vehicles available today.

Adding to its appeal is the ID.7 Pro S's fast charging capability, which allows users to recharge from 10% to 80% within just 26 minutes via its 200 kW DC charging feature. This rapid charging performance is set to make it popular among everyday users and long-distance travelers alike.
